S. Matthew Devine | Bail interviewer, 86

S. Matthew Devine, 86, a bail interviewer for Delaware County from 1977 to last year, died of prostate cancer Wednesday at Kennedy Memorial Hospitals-University Medical Center/Stratford. Since April, he and his wife, Bernice, had lived in West Deptford.

From 1957 until he went to work for Delaware County, Mr. Devine owned Devine's Children's Store in the Manoa Shopping Center in Havertown, said his daughter, Susan Woods. In the early 1950s, he sold insurance in North Jersey.

A 1941 graduate of Clifton Heights High School, he earned a bachelor's degree in business administration from Upsala College in East Orange, N.J., in 1950.

During World War II, he was an Army radar operator who served in Germany. He was decorated "for protecting valuable kitchen equipment during an air raid," his daughter said with a laugh.

Besides his wife of 62 years and his daughter, Mr. Devine is survived by sons Mark, Paul and Christopher; 10 grandchildren; and five great-grandchildren.
